Automated Patient Recall and Appointment Scheduling
Dental practices rely heavily on consistent patient flow to maintain revenue. Proactive outreach for routine check-ups and follow-ups is crucial for preventative care and maximizing chair time. Automating this process ensures patients are reminded of their needs and appointments are filled efficiently, reducing gaps in the schedule.
Streamlined Insurance Verification and Eligibility Checks
Manual insurance verification is time-consuming and prone to errors, leading to claim denials and delayed payments. Accurate and timely eligibility checks are essential for accurate patient billing and reducing administrative overhead. Automating this process frees up staff for more complex tasks and improves revenue cycle management.
AI-Powered Patient In-take and Data Entry
The initial patient intake process involves collecting significant personal and medical information, which is often handled manually. This can lead to data entry errors and delays in patient processing. Automating data capture and entry can improve accuracy, speed up the check-in process, and enhance the patient experience.
Automated Accounts Receivable Follow-up
Managing outstanding patient balances and insurance claims is critical for a practice's financial health. Manual follow-up is labor-intensive and can lead to extended payment cycles. Automating this process ensures consistent communication with patients and payers, improving cash flow.
Intelligent Medical Coding Assistance
Accurate medical coding is fundamental to proper billing and reimbursement. Errors in coding can lead to claim rejections, audits, and financial losses. AI can assist coders by suggesting appropriate codes based on clinical documentation, improving accuracy and efficiency.
Proactive Appointment Reminder and Confirmation System
No-shows and last-minute cancellations significantly disrupt practice schedules and impact revenue. Effective communication before appointments is key to reducing these occurrences. An automated system ensures patients receive timely reminders and can easily confirm or reschedule.
